Output ef25fdf0ab7987619ef112ddba705bbdfc889ce5ab7af270e1918cb45786f312:10

value
8233354
script pubkey
OP_0 OP_PUSHBYTES_32 b85d4f4d713ebf72cc31b4af33d392f188e81a0d8c23a78a04bd9702432625fb
address
bc1qhpw57nt386lh9np3kjhn85uj7xywsxsd3s360zsyhktsysexyhassa99r9
transaction
ef25fdf0ab7987619ef112ddba705bbdfc889ce5ab7af270e1918cb45786f312
spent
true